Output 5faf33434e3af3642eb46eb54ef18b04ef3d85876af494e1ec0ff905b8e0cc06:98

value
577640
script pubkey
OP_0 OP_PUSHBYTES_20 388bea199498883b43cb61cddf2a17c6ab2c313c
address
bc1q8z975xv5nzyrks7tv8xa72shc64jcvfurz4z5p
transaction
5faf33434e3af3642eb46eb54ef18b04ef3d85876af494e1ec0ff905b8e0cc06
spent
true